Position Summary:
The Physician Assistant will provide medical services under physician supervision, including patient histories, physical exams, diagnostic tests, and treatment plan implementation. Responsibilities encompass professional development, training, patient assessment, counseling, coordination of care, compliance with regulations, and contributing to a diverse working environment.
Responsibilities:
Conduct patient histories, physical exams, and diagnostic tests. Develop and implement treatment plans in line with clinical protocols. Monitor therapeutic interventions and patient progress. Offer counseling and education on medical aspects of treatment. Coordinate care with healthcare providers and make referrals as needed. Ensure compliance with medical quality standards and regulations. Attend treatment team meetings and training seminars. Maintain current knowledge of drug abuse trends and treatment. Collaborate with other healthcare providers as necessary. Assist nursing team and perform other duties as assigned.
Qualifications:
Valid Physician Assistant license in the state of employment. Current DEA license and documentation of renewal. Experience or understanding of chemical addiction preferred. High integrity, sound judgment, and efficient work ethic. Strong communication and interpersonal skills. Ability to work independently under pressure. Proficiency in basic computing and data entry. Knowledge of medical equipment and procedures.
Physical Demands and Working Conditions:
Adequate speaking, hearing, and vision abilities. Prolonged standing, bending, and keyboarding. Variable workload with periodic high stress. Standard medical office conditions and patient interactions. Use of protective equipment may be required. Why Join BHG?
